The Influence of Heroes on Acehnese Literature

Acehnese literature, known for its rich tradition of storytelling and poetry, has been profoundly influenced by the exploits of its heroes. The tales of these heroes, often depicted as courageous warriors and righteous leaders, have served as a source of inspiration for countless literary works. These stories, passed down orally for generations, were eventually documented in written form, becoming an integral part of Acehnese literary heritage. The heroic deeds of figures like Sultan Iskandar Muda, known for his military prowess and expansion of the Acehnese kingdom, have been immortalized in epic poems and historical chronicles. These literary works not only celebrate the achievements of these heroes but also serve as a testament to the values and ideals that they embodied.

The Impact of Heroes on Acehnese Music and Dance

Acehnese music and dance are deeply rooted in the province's cultural heritage, and the influence of heroes is evident in many forms of artistic expression. The traditional music of Aceh, characterized by its rhythmic beats and melodic tunes, often incorporates themes of heroism and valor. The lyrics of these songs frequently recount the exploits of legendary figures, celebrating their bravery and sacrifice. Similarly, Acehnese dance forms, such as the "Ratoh Duek" and the "Seudati," often depict scenes from the lives of heroes, showcasing their strength, agility, and grace. These dances, performed at various cultural events and ceremonies, serve as a visual representation of the values and ideals that these heroes embodied.
